





/*
	Mosaic - Sliding Boxes and Captions jQuery Plugin
	Version 1.0.1
	www.buildinternet.com/project/mosaic
	
	By Sam Dunn / One Mighty Roar (www.onemightyroar.com)
	Released under MIT License / GPL License
*/

* {
  margin:0;
  padding:0;
  border:none;
  outline:none;
}

/*General Mosaic Styles*/
.mosaic-block {
  float:left;
  position:relative;
  overflow:hidden;
  width:231px;
  height:214px;
  background:#111 url(http://www.arenaelectoral.com/images/progress.gif) no-repeat center center;
}

.mosaic-backdrop {
  display:none;
  position:absolute;
  top:0;
  height:100%;
  width:100%;
  background:#888;
  overflow: hidden;
}

.mosaic-block-vid {
  float:left;
  position:relative;
  overflow:hidden;
  width:231px;
  height:140px;
  background:#111 url(http://www.arenaelectoral.com/images/progress.gif) no-repeat center center;
}

.mosaic-backdrop img{
  width: 100%;
}

.mosaic-overlay {
  display:none;
  z-index:5;
  position:absolute;
  width:100%;
  height:100%;
  background:#111;
}

.mosaic-block h5{
  position: relative;
  z-index: 2000;
  left:160px;
  margin-top: 5px;
  margin-right: 2px;
  padding: 4px 2px 4px 2px;
}

.mosaic-block h5 img{
  /*max-height: 80px;*/
}

.mosaic-backdrop h2{
  margin-top: 8px;
  margin-left: 10px;
  color:#000;
  font-family: DejaWeb;
  font-weight: normal;
  font-size: 14px;
  text-transform: uppercase;
}

.mosaic-backdrop h1{
  margin-top: 3px;
  margin-left: 10px;
  margin-right: 10px;
  font-family: Bebas;
  font-weight: normal;
  font-size: 26px;
  color: #fff;
}

.mosaic-backdrop p{
  margin-top: 5px;
  margin-left: 10px;
  margin-right: 8px;
  font-family: Chapa;
  font-size: 14px;
  color: #222;
}
	
/*** Custom Animation Styles (You can remove/add any styles below) ***/
.circle .mosaic-overlay {
  background:url(http://www.arenaelectoral.com/images/hover-magnify.png) no-repeat center center;
  opacity:0;
  -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=00)";
  filter:alpha(opacity=00);
  display:none;
}
		
.fade .mosaic-overlay {
  opacity:0;
  -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=00)";
  filter:alpha(opacity=00);
  background:url(http://www.arenaelectoral.com/images/bg-black.png);
}
		
.bar .mosaic-overlay {
  bottom:-100px;
  height:100px;
  background:url(http://www.arenaelectoral.com/img/bg-black.png);
}
		
.bar2 .mosaic-overlay {
  bottom:-85px;
  height:120px;
  opacity:0.8;
  -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=80)";
  filter:alpha(opacity=80);
}
		
.bar2 .mosaic-overlay:hover {
  opacity:1;
  -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=100)";
  filter:alpha(opacity=100);
}

.bar3 .mosaic-overlay:hover {
  opacity:1;
  -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=100)";
  filter:alpha(opacity=100);
}
	
.bar3 .mosaic-overlay {
  bottom:-85px;
  height:120px;
  opacity:0.8;
  -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=80)";
  filter:alpha(opacity=80);
}

/*** End Animation Styles ***/
